Define Vendor / Cost / "Schedule" / at Sales order
When I make a Drop Ship Sales order. I want to define define the vendor cost.
My vendor has 2 terms of sale Ex-Works, or FOB, If the total drop ship item quantity if over 500, then they get FOB. FOB lets say is $20, If they order less then 500 then its Ex-Works of $18.79
One option I thought of was to use the "Schedule" Discount on the vendor, but that is only a % base and these are not always a nice round % Also for orders over 500 the price is higher. (due to the shipping terms)
Another thought was to setup 2 different vendors, "Vendor - FOB" and "Vendor Ex-Work" and just set the price for the item from those different vendors.
